Motoring Memories: Toyota Corolla, 1966

Thumbnail The first Toyota Corolla was designed with Japan’s export market in mind, but it proved surprisingly popular in Japan as well. The small car offered decent performance for its time and attractive styling, particularly the fastback Sprinter model.

Toyota tops “Cash for Clunkers” purchase list

Thumbnail The Toyota Corolla was the most frequently purchased car under the U.S. "Cash for Clunkers" program, which offered rebates of up to US$4,500 for consumers who traded in older vehicles for recycling and purchased new, more fuel-efficient vehicles.

What’s New: 2010 Toyota Corolla

Completely redesigned for 2009, the Toyota Corolla has few changes for 2010. Most notable is that stability control, previously standard only on the XRS, is now standard on the S and LE, and optional on the base CE model. Read the article | View the photos | All the 2009 Models
